The Role As an integral part of the sales and services team, the FSR, as the first point of contact with members and potential members, is fully knowledgeable of features, benefits, target market, and operating conditions (including required documents) of the full range of personal products and services offered by the credit union. To ensure high levels of service are maintained the FSR may be called upon to assist other FSR’s and complete routine transactions for members. The FSR is responsible for servicing members consistent with the credit union’s objectives for member service and profitability. The FSR promotes retention of quality, profitable member relationships by thoroughly resolving both ongoing member satisfaction with the credit union’s products and services and supporting the achievement of branch objectives Process routine teller transactions initiated in person, online, by phone, email Complete direct deposit forms, and payroll deductions, personal information changes Input member credit card applications and follows up accordingly. Process cheque orders through third party supplier and follows up accordingly. Maintain cash custody, balance cash daily, adheres to teller transaction limits Adheres to operational policies and procedures. Responsible for cash orders. Submit cheque images for deposit through Central One. Responding to inquiries regarding registered products (RRSP, RRIF, TFSA) Process RRSP and TFSA withdrawals, deposits, transfers, and other transactions. Process new term deposits, renewals and cancellation instructions Resolve ATM card and POS transaction problems or concerns. Prepare Wire requests.
